Benefits of removing unnecessary software from the computer

Removing unnecessary software is a simple, effective way to free up space and speed up the computer.

During the process of using a computer, users often install many software for work, study or entertainment. However, over time, some software is no longer used or simply is not necessary. retention of these software can cause many problems for the performance and stability of the system. Therefore, removing unnecessary software brings many important benefits to computer users.

Increasing computer performance

Unnecessary software, even if not opened, can still run underground in the system and consume resources such as RAM, CPU or hard drive. When they are removed, the computer will reduce unnecessary workload, thereby increasing processing and response speed, helping the machine operate more smoothly.

Relieve drive capacity

Software often takes up a large amount of space in the hard drive, especially heavy software such as games, photo or video editing apps. Removing these software helps free up storage memory, creating space for important data and other necessary applications.

Reducing the risk of software conflicts and system errors

When too much software is installed, the risk of conflicts between applications can occur, causing system errors or making the computer operate unstably. Removing unnecessary software helps the system run more stably and reduces the possibility of unwanted errors.

Enhancing computer security

Some unused software may not be updated regularly, creating security vulnerabilities for the computer. In addition, some software downloaded from unreliable sources may contain malware or spyware. Removing unknown software or unused software will help protect your computer from cybersecurity threats.

Optimizing user experience

A compact computer with less junk software will help users easily manage, search for applications and focus more on key tasks. The system interface also becomes clear and clean, bringing a comfortable feeling when using.

Note

Removing unnecessary software is an important step in the process of maintaining and optimizing the computer. This is a simple action but brings practical results, from improving performance to protecting personal information security. Users should regularly check and remove unused software to ensure the computer always operates stably and efficiently.
